Поделиться через


InfoVetted (предварительная версия)

Решение для проверки занятости InfoVetted упрощает проверку кандидатов и сотрудников, позволяя эффективно контактировать и проверять запросы, помогая организациям оставаться в соответствии с требованиями и принимать обоснованные решения о найме.

Этот соединитель доступен в следующих продуктах и регионах:

Услуга Class Регионы
Copilot Studio Премия Все регионы Power Automate , кроме следующих:
     - Правительство США (GCC)
     - Правительство США (GCC High)
     — Облако Китая, управляемое 21Vianet
     - Министерство обороны США (DoD)
Логические приложения Стандарт Все регионы Logic Apps , кроме следующих:
     — Регионы Azure для государственных организаций
     — Регионы Azure Для Китая
     - Министерство обороны США (DoD)
Power Apps Премия Все регионы Power Apps , кроме следующих:
     - Правительство США (GCC)
     - Правительство США (GCC High)
     — Облако Китая, управляемое 21Vianet
     - Министерство обороны США (DoD)
Power Automate Премия Все регионы Power Automate , кроме следующих:
     - Правительство США (GCC)
     - Правительство США (GCC High)
     — Облако Китая, управляемое 21Vianet
     - Министерство обороны США (DoD)
Контакт
Имя InfoVetted
URL https://infovetted.com
Адрес электронной почты info@infovetted.com
Метаданные соединителя
Publisher InfoVetted
Website https://www.infovetted.com
Политика конфиденциальности https://www.infovetted.com/privacy-policy
Категории Безопасность; Управление бизнесом

Соединитель InfoVetted Vetting

InfoVetted предоставляет соединитель для проверки занятости кандидатов и сотрудников, таких как проверка личности (IDV), право на работу (RTW), уголовное - раскрытие и запрет службы (DBS) и финансистические проверки фона.

Соединитель также поддерживает запрос состояния запрошенной проверки и скачивания результатов проверки в формате PDF.

Издатель: InfoVetted

Предпосылки

  • Ключ API является обязательным, необходимо зарегистрироваться и зарегистрировать бизнес в InfoVetted , чтобы использовать соединитель.

Поддерживаемые операции

Соединитель поддерживает следующие операции:

GetAllVettingRequests

GetVettingRequestsByContactId

CreateContactVettingRequest

Запросить проверку проверки. Доступны следующие типы проверок:

  • RightToWork
  • StandardDBS
  • Расширенные базы данных
  • BasicDBS
  • WorkHistory3years
  • WorkHistory5years

При запросе проверки DBS используйте один из следующих секторов занятости

Секторы занятости

  • AcademyEducation
  • РазмещениеAndFoodService
  • AdministrativeAndSupport
  • Сельское хозяйство
  • ArtAndEntertainment
  • CentralGovernment
  • ChildCare
  • Строительство
  • Drivers
  • EnergyAndAirConditioning
  • FinancialAndInsurance
  • ForestryAndFishing
  • ФостерДопция
  • Дальнейшие инструкции
  • HigherEducation
  • Независимое создание
  • InformationAndCommunication
  • LawEnforcementAndSecurity
  • ОтдыхSportAndTourism
  • LocalGovernment
  • Производство
  • MiningAndQuarrying
  • NHS
  • Дошкольная обучение
  • PrimaryEducation
  • PrivateHealthcare
  • ProfessionalTechnical
  • PublicSectorOther
  • RealEstateActivities
  • НаборAndHR
  • Розничная торговля
  • Вторичное образование
  • SocialCare
  • TradeOrRepairOfVehicles
  • ТранспортAndStorage
  • Добровольная диаграмма
  • WaterAndWasteManagement

Обновления состояния проверки будут отправлены в адрес веб-перехватчика (необязательно), указанный в следующем формате.

Полезные данные POST webhook POST:

{
    "CheckId": "",
    "Status": "",
    "StatusDescription": ""
}

Статусы:

  • NotStarted,
  • InProgress,
  • Полный
  • Уничтоженный
  • PendingApproval,
  • Отклонено
  • Истек
  • Архив
  • Неизвестно

CancelAnExistingVettingRequest

Состояние проверки

Возвращает состояние проверки запрошенной проверки

Статусы:

  • NotStarted,
  • InProgress,
  • Полный
  • Уничтоженный
  • PendingApproval,
  • Отклонено
  • Истек
  • Архив
  • Неизвестно

Экспорт PDF

Возвращает результат PDF для завершенного проверки

CreateContact

Создает контакт для проверки

GetContact

Возвращает контакт

UpdateContact

Обновление контакта

GetAllContacts

Получение списка всех контактов

GetAssignedGroupsForContact

Возвращает список групп, к которым принадлежит контакт

GetContactGroup

Получение группы контактов

CreateContactGroup

Создание группы контактов

UpdateContactGroup

Обновление группы контактов

GetAllContactGroups

Получение всех групп контактов

DeleteContactGroup

Удаление группы контактов

AddContactToContactGroup

Добавление контакта в группу

RemoveContactFromContactGroup

Удаление контакта из группы

Получение учетных данных

Ключ API можно получить на портале InfoVetted в разделе "Параметры = ключи API =>>первичный ключ".

Ключи API InfoVetted

У вас должна быть активная подписка на соответствующий продукт или включена выставление счетов.

Известные проблемы и ограничения

Известные проблемы отсутствуют

Support

Для любых вопросов здесь или отправьте сообщение электронной почты. info@infovetted.com

Инструкции по развертыванию

Используйте эти инструкции для развертывания этого соединителя в качестве пользовательского соединителя в Microsoft Power Automate и Power Apps

Создание подключения

Соединитель поддерживает следующие типы проверки подлинности:

По умолчанию Параметры для создания подключения. Все регионы Недоступен для совместного использования

По умолчанию

Применимо: все регионы

Параметры для создания подключения.

Это недоступно для общего доступа. Если приложение power предоставляется другому пользователю, пользователю будет предложено явно создать новое подключение.

Имя Тип Description Обязательно
apiKeyHeader securestring ApiKeyHeader для этого API True

Ограничения регулирования

Имя Вызовы Период обновления
Вызовы API для каждого подключения 100 60 секунд

Действия

Добавление контакта в группу контактов

Эта конечная точка добавляет существующий контакт в определенную группу контактов.

Обновление контактных данных

Эта конечная точка обновляет сведения о существующем контакте.

Обновление существующей группы контактов

Эта конечная точка обновляет сведения о существующей группе контактов по идентификатору.

Отмена запроса проверки exisitng

Эта конечная точка отменяет существующий запрос проверки.

Получение всех групп контактов

Эта конечная точка извлекает все группы контактов, связанные с подпиской.

Получение всех запросов проверки

Эта конечная точка извлекает все запросы проверки с необязательными параметрами разбиения на страницы.

Получение всех контактов

Эта конечная точка извлекает все контакты с необязательной разбивкой на страницы.

Получение группы контактов

Эта конечная точка получает сведения о определенной группе контактов по идентификатору.

Получение запросов проверки по идентификатору контакта

Эта конечная точка получает запросы проверки, связанные с определенным идентификатором контакта.

Получение контактных данных

Эта конечная точка получает сведения о контакте по его идентификатору.

Получение назначенных групп для контакта

Эта конечная точка извлекает группы, назначенные конкретному контакту по идентификатору.

Получение состояния проверки для заданного параметра vettingRequestId

Эта конечная точка возвращает состояние проверки заданной проверки, определяемой параметром VettingRequestId.

Результат проверки экспорта в формате PDF

Эта конечная точка создает и экспортирует PDF-документ для указанной проверки, определенной параметром VettingRequestId.

Создание запроса проверки контакта

Эта конечная точка создает новый запрос проверки для контакта.

Создание нового контакта

Эта конечная точка создает новый контакт на основе входных параметров.

Создание новой группы контактов

Эта конечная точка создает новую группу контактов с указанным именем.

Удаление группы контактов

Эта конечная точка удаляет группу контактов по его идентификатору.

Удаление контакта из группы контактов

Эта конечная точка удаляет существующий контакт из определенной группы контактов.

Добавление контакта в группу контактов

Эта конечная точка добавляет существующий контакт в определенную группу контактов.

Параметры

Имя Ключ Обязательно Тип Описание
contactGroupId
contactGroupId string
contactId
contactId string

Возвращаемое значение

response
object

Обновление контактных данных

Эта конечная точка обновляет сведения о существующем контакте.

Параметры

Имя Ключ Обязательно Тип Описание
Имя
firstName string
lastName
lastName string
электронная почта
email string
номер телефона
phoneNumber string
contactId
contactId string

Возвращаемое значение

Обновление существующей группы контактов

Эта конечная точка обновляет сведения о существующей группе контактов по идентификатору.

Параметры

Имя Ключ Обязательно Тип Описание
contactGroupId
contactGroupId string
имя
name string

Возвращаемое значение

Отмена запроса проверки exisitng

Эта конечная точка отменяет существующий запрос проверки.

Параметры

Имя Ключ Обязательно Тип Описание
vettingRequestId
vettingRequestId integer

Возвращаемое значение

Получение всех групп контактов

Эта конечная точка извлекает все группы контактов, связанные с подпиской.

Возвращаемое значение

Получение всех запросов проверки

Эта конечная точка извлекает все запросы проверки с необязательными параметрами разбиения на страницы.

Параметры

Имя Ключ Обязательно Тип Описание
Направление сортировки
Direction string

Направление сортировки, например asc или desc.

Смещение разбиения на страницы
Offset integer

Формат — int32. Смещение разбиения на страницы.

Ограничение разбиения на страницы
Limit integer

Формат — int32. Ограничение разбиения на страницы.

Возвращаемое значение

Получение всех контактов

Эта конечная точка извлекает все контакты с необязательной разбивкой на страницы.

Параметры

Имя Ключ Обязательно Тип Описание
Направление сортировки (asc или desc)
Direction string

Направление сортировки (asc или desc).

Смещение — int32. Смещение разбиения на страницы
Offset integer

Формат — int32. Смещение разбиения на страницы.

Ограничение разбиения на страницы
Limit integer

Формат — int32. Ограничение разбиения на страницы.

Возвращаемое значение

Получение группы контактов

Эта конечная точка получает сведения о определенной группе контактов по идентификатору.

Параметры

Имя Ключ Обязательно Тип Описание
The ContactGroupId. Формат — uuid
ContactGroupId True uuid

Формат — uuid. Уникальный идентификатор группы контактов.

Возвращаемое значение

Получение запросов проверки по идентификатору контакта

Эта конечная точка получает запросы проверки, связанные с определенным идентификатором контакта.

Параметры

Имя Ключ Обязательно Тип Описание
Идентификатор контакта — формат — uuid
ContactId True uuid

Формат — uuid. Уникальный идентификатор контакта.

Направление сортировки
Direction string

Направление сортировки, например asc или desc.

Смещение разбиения на страницы
Offset integer

Формат — int32. Смещение разбиения на страницы.

Ограничение разбиения на страницы
Limit integer

Формат — int32. Ограничение разбиения на страницы.

Возвращаемое значение

Получение контактных данных

Эта конечная точка получает сведения о контакте по его идентификатору.

Параметры

Имя Ключ Обязательно Тип Описание
Идентификатор контакта. Формат — uuid
ContactId True uuid

Формат — uuid. Уникальный идентификатор контакта.

Возвращаемое значение

Получение назначенных групп для контакта

Эта конечная точка извлекает группы, назначенные конкретному контакту по идентификатору.

Параметры

Имя Ключ Обязательно Тип Описание
contactId
ContactId True uuid

Формат — uuid. Уникальный идентификатор контакта.

Возвращаемое значение

Получение состояния проверки для заданного параметра vettingRequestId

Эта конечная точка возвращает состояние проверки заданной проверки, определяемой параметром VettingRequestId.

Параметры

Имя Ключ Обязательно Тип Описание
Параметр VettingRequestId
VettingRequestId True integer

Формат — int32. Параметр VettingRequestId , который является уникальным идентификатором для проверки.

Возвращаемое значение

Результат проверки экспорта в формате PDF

Эта конечная точка создает и экспортирует PDF-документ для указанной проверки, определенной параметром VettingRequestId.

Параметры

Имя Ключ Обязательно Тип Описание
Параметр VettingRequestId
VettingRequestId True string

Параметр VettingRequestId , который является уникальным идентификатором для vettingRequest.

Возвращаемое значение

Создание запроса проверки контакта

Эта конечная точка создает новый запрос проверки для контакта.

Параметры

Имя Ключ Обязательно Тип Описание
CheckType
CheckType string

Тип проверки для запроса проверки.

contactId
contactId string
yourReference
yourReference string
NotifyContactPreference
NotifyContactPreference string
webhookUrl
webhookUrl string
identityVerified
identityVerified boolean
identityVerifiedBy
identityVerifiedBy string
jobTitleOfIndividual
jobTitleOfIndividual string
ТрудоустройствоSector
EmploymentSector string
isVolunteer
isVolunteer boolean
isWorkingWithVulnerableAdults
isWorkingWithVulnerableAdults boolean
isWorkingWithChildren
isWorkingWithChildren boolean
hasIndividualsAddressBeenChecked
hasIndividualsAddressBeenChecked boolean
isWorkingAtVulnerablePersonsHomeAddress
isWorkingAtVulnerablePersonsHomeAddress boolean

Возвращаемое значение

Тело
vettingResponse

Создание нового контакта

Эта конечная точка создает новый контакт на основе входных параметров.

Параметры

Имя Ключ Обязательно Тип Описание
Имя
firstName string
lastName
lastName string
электронная почта
email string
номер телефона
phoneNumber string

Возвращаемое значение

Тело
contactResponse

Создание новой группы контактов

Эта конечная точка создает новую группу контактов с указанным именем.

Параметры

Имя Ключ Обязательно Тип Описание
имя
name string

Возвращаемое значение

Удаление группы контактов

Эта конечная точка удаляет группу контактов по его идентификатору.

Параметры

Имя Ключ Обязательно Тип Описание
contactGroupId
contactGroupId string

Возвращаемое значение

response
object

Удаление контакта из группы контактов

Эта конечная точка удаляет существующий контакт из определенной группы контактов.

Параметры

Имя Ключ Обязательно Тип Описание
contactGroupId
contactGroupId string
contactId
contactId string

Возвращаемое значение

Определения

allContactsResponse

Имя Путь Тип Описание
items
items array of getContactResponse
общееКоличествоЭлементов
totalItems integer

cancelVettingResponse

Имя Путь Тип Описание
Успешно выполнено
succeeded boolean
код
code string
traceId
traceId string

checkResponse

Имя Путь Тип Описание
id
id integer
Имя
firstName string
фамилия
surname string
dateOfBirth
dateOfBirth string
электронная почта
email string
номер телефона
phoneNumber string
справочник
reference string
createdDateTime
createdDateTime string
checkType
checkType string
contactId
contactId string
latestVettingStatus
latestVettingStatus string
vettingStatuses
vettingStatuses array of vettingStatusViewModel

contactResponse

Имя Путь Тип Описание
isDuplicate
isDuplicate boolean
сообщение
message string
contactId
contactId string
Имя
firstName string
lastName
lastName string
электронная почта
email string
номер телефона
phoneNumber string

createContactGroupResponse

Имя Путь Тип Описание
contactGroupId
contactGroupId string
имя
name string
createdDateTime
createdDateTime string

getAllContactGroupsResponse

Имя Путь Тип Описание
totalCount
totalCount integer
контактГруппы
contactGroups array of getContactGroupResponse

getAllVettingRequestsResponse

Имя Путь Тип Описание
items
items array of checkResponse
общееКоличествоЭлементов
totalItems integer

getAssignedGroupsForContactResponse

Имя Путь Тип Описание
id
id string
имя
name string
дата создания
createdDate string

getContactGroupResponse

Имя Путь Тип Описание
contactGroupId
contactGroupId string
имя
name string
createdTime
createdTime string
count
count integer

getContactResponse

Имя Путь Тип Описание
id
id string
Имя
firstName string
lastName
lastName string
электронная почта
email string
номер телефона
phoneNumber string
регистрацияAccepted
registrationAccepted boolean
acceptedRegistrationDate
acceptedRegistrationDate string
recordCreationSource
recordCreationSource string
createdDateTime
createdDateTime string
updatedDateTime
updatedDateTime string

removeContactFromContactGroupResponse

Имя Путь Тип Описание
contactListId
contactListId string
contactId
contactId string

updateContactGroupResponse

Имя Путь Тип Описание
contactGroupId
contactGroupId string
имя
name string
createdTime
createdTime string
count
count integer

vettingRequestRecordReferenceResponse

Имя Путь Тип Описание
id
id integer
checkType
checkType string

vettingResponse

Имя Путь Тип Описание
Успешно выполнено
succeeded boolean
vettingRequestRecordReferences
vettingRequestRecordReferences array of vettingRequestRecordReferenceResponse
код
code string
traceId
traceId string

vettingStatusResponse

Имя Путь Тип Описание
статус
status string
latestVettingStatusDescription
latestVettingStatusDescription string

vettingStatusViewModel

Имя Путь Тип Описание
статус
status string
createdDateTime
createdDateTime string

PDFExportGet200ApplicationJsonResponse

getAssignedGroupsForContactResponseArray

Имя Путь Тип Описание
Товары
getAssignedGroupsForContactResponse

объект

Это тип object.